Barcelona will be looking to consolidate their spot on top of Group E in the 2015/16 UEFA Champions League when they travel to face BATE in Matchday 3.
Join The Roar for live scores from 5:45am (AEDT).
Barcelona haven’t fired up in the first two rounds of the Champions League, playing out a 1-1 draw with Roma, followed by a 2-1 win at home against Bayer.
Their opponents today are coming off a 3-2 win at home against Roma, a strong rebound from their disappointing opening round flogging at the hand of Bayer.
Barcelona have a star studded squad, but the man to watch today will undoubtedly be Neymar, who is coming off an incredible four-goal effort against Rayo Vallecano at Camp Nou on the weekend.
With Lionel Messi and Andres Iniesta sidelined with injuries, all the focus will be on the Brazilian star.
If he can pick up where he left off on Matchday 8 of La Liga, BATE will struggled to get close to the Spanish giants today.
BATE will enter the match as huge underdogs, however will be buoyed after having secured their tenth successive title in Belarus on Friday.
Can BATE stop the might of Barcelona? Or will the Catalans charge closer to another Round of 16 berth?
